Role Overview
Dudhi Industries Pvt Ltd. is seeking an Assistant Manager-Sales with strong hands-on experience in private project sales of building materials, construction products, infrastructure products, preferably FRP, GFRP, SMC, or composite-based products.
This is a core execution-driven role involving private developers, EPC contractors, industrial customers, consultants, architects, PMCs, utilities, and infrastructure companies across India. The role requires a deep understanding of project sales, specification selling, technical approvals, business development, and project execution.

4. Project Sales Management
- Lead the complete project sales cycle:
o Opportunity identification
o Technical discussions and presentations
o Proposal submission
o Commercial negotiations
o Order closure
- Coordinate with internal teams to ensure timely and accurate responses to customer requirements.

7. Specification Selling & Product Approval
- Get company products approved in:
o Consultant drawings
o Project specifications
o BOQs
o Technical submittals
o Infrastructure and industrial project documents
- Conduct technical presentations and site-level engagement activities.
